Forwarded from Типичный программист
XPipe: инструмент для доступа ко всей серверной инфраструктуре с рабочего стола
Объединяет SSH, Docker, Kubernetes, WSL, Proxmox и другие технологии без сложной настройки в удобный интерфейс. Работает поверх установленных CLI-инструментов, позволяя управлять серверами, контейнерами и виртуальными машинами без установки агентов.
Можно управлять удалёнными файлами без SFTP, прокидывать SSH-туннели, использовать локальные редакторы с автосинхронизацией на сервер и даже сохранять конфиги в Git для удобного доступа на всех устройствах.
Если устали переключаться между терминалами и вкладками — стоит попробовать👍
#инструменты
Объединяет SSH, Docker, Kubernetes, WSL, Proxmox и другие технологии без сложной настройки в удобный интерфейс. Работает поверх установленных CLI-инструментов, позволяя управлять серверами, контейнерами и виртуальными машинами без установки агентов.
Можно управлять удалёнными файлами без SFTP, прокидывать SSH-туннели, использовать локальные редакторы с автосинхронизацией на сервер и даже сохранять конфиги в Git для удобного доступа на всех устройствах.
Если устали переключаться между терминалами и вкладками — стоит попробовать
#инструменты
Please open Telegram to view this post
VIEW IN TELEGRAM
Please open Telegram to view this post
VIEW IN TELEGRAM
Hacking-Books | Устраиваемся в Anonymous
Большая подборка книг по взлому почти всего в сети: сайты, приложения, базы данных (100+ учебников). Пишем вирусы, лезем под капот криптовалют. В общем, ̶зл̶о̶в̶р̶е̶д̶и̶м̶ работаем белыми хакерами.
Цена: бесплатно
Репозиторий проекта
⚡ — пробовал взламывать
🗿 — не мое
@prog_tools
Большая подборка книг по взлому почти всего в сети: сайты, приложения, базы данных (100+ учебников). Пишем вирусы, лезем под капот криптовалют. В общем, ̶зл̶о̶в̶р̶е̶д̶и̶м̶ работаем белыми хакерами.
Цена: бесплатно
Репозиторий проекта
⚡ — пробовал взламывать
🗿 — не мое
@prog_tools
codegen | Вертим кодовой базой
Утилита, позволяющая манипулировать сразу несколькими технологиями; Python, Typescript, Javascript и React. Если репозитории — это содержимое карманов, то вы — Вассерман, который потряхивает жилетку с целью уложить содержимое получше.
⚡ — сгодится
🗿 — лучше вручную
Цена: бесплатно
Репозиторий проекта
@prog_tools
Утилита, позволяющая манипулировать сразу несколькими технологиями; Python, Typescript, Javascript и React. Если репозитории — это содержимое карманов, то вы — Вассерман, который потряхивает жилетку с целью уложить содержимое получше.
⚡ — сгодится
🗿 — лучше вручную
Цена: бесплатно
Репозиторий проекта
@prog_tools
Конвейер DevOps, часть 2: пользуемся Fedora Core и mise
Ментор Эйч Навыки и действующий кодер рассказал,
как Fedora Core и Mise помогают автоматизировать процесс разработки и деплоя. Достаточно хардкорный пошаговый гайд о создании стабильной и безопасной среды.
p.s. Первая часть цикла статей здесь.
@prog_tools
Ментор Эйч Навыки и действующий кодер рассказал,
как Fedora Core и Mise помогают автоматизировать процесс разработки и деплоя. Достаточно хардкорный пошаговый гайд о создании стабильной и безопасной среды.
p.s. Первая часть цикла статей здесь.
@prog_tools
Бэкенд — это тоже красиво: как метрики и мониторинг делают вашу работу заметной
Руководитель разработки из Газпромбанка подчеркнул в своей статье важность визуализации данных и использования инструментов мониторинга.
На примере вы узнаете, как с Docker, JDK17 и Grafana создают действительно полезный dataviz, и даже разницу между DevOps и SRE.
@prog_tools
Руководитель разработки из Газпромбанка подчеркнул в своей статье важность визуализации данных и использования инструментов мониторинга.
На примере вы узнаете, как с Docker, JDK17 и Grafana создают действительно полезный dataviz, и даже разницу между DevOps и SRE.
@prog_tools
PRevent | Защищаем свой репозиторий от коммитов-зловредов
Это сэлфхост-приложение прослушивает события запросов на слияние и сканирует их на наличие вредоносного кода. Для отлова используется набор правил Apiiro для Semgrep и дополнительные детекторы на Python, чтобы эффективно обезвреживать трюки вроде обфускации.
Награда «Секурный инструмент месяца» на канале 🛡️
Цена: бесплатно
Репозиторий проекта
@prog_tools
Это сэлфхост-приложение прослушивает события запросов на слияние и сканирует их на наличие вредоносного кода. Для отлова используется набор правил Apiiro для Semgrep и дополнительные детекторы на Python, чтобы эффективно обезвреживать трюки вроде обфускации.
Награда «Секурный инструмент месяца» на канале 🛡️
Цена: бесплатно
Репозиторий проекта
@prog_tools
whatsmeow | Go-клиент WhatsApp
Библиотека позволяет разработчикам интегрировать функциональность WhatsApp в свои приложения, обеспечивая доступ к основным возможностям мессенджера. Если научить свою бабушку Go, то она сможет отправлять кринжовые открытки всей своей базе контактов каждый день 😉
Прямиком из топовых репо GitHub.
Цена: бесплатно
Репозиторий проекта
@prog_tools
Библиотека позволяет разработчикам интегрировать функциональность WhatsApp в свои приложения, обеспечивая доступ к основным возможностям мессенджера. Если научить свою бабушку Go, то она сможет отправлять кринжовые открытки всей своей базе контактов каждый день 😉
Прямиком из топовых репо GitHub.
Цена: бесплатно
Репозиторий проекта
@prog_tools
Хакеры уходят от C++ — вирусы на Haskell и Delphi труднее анализировать
Эксперты кибербеза отметили, что традиционно злоумышленники использовали более распространенные языки, такие как C и C++, однако переход на Haskell и Delphi делает анализ вирусов более сложным из-за особенностей этих языков.
Haskell, будучи функциональным языком, предлагает уникальные подходы к программированию, что затрудняет применение стандартных методов анализа вредоносного кода. Delphi, в свою очередь, известен своей способностью создавать компактные и эффективные приложения, что также усложняет их детектирование антивирусными системами.
@prog_tools
Эксперты кибербеза отметили, что традиционно злоумышленники использовали более распространенные языки, такие как C и C++, однако переход на Haskell и Delphi делает анализ вирусов более сложным из-за особенностей этих языков.
Haskell, будучи функциональным языком, предлагает уникальные подходы к программированию, что затрудняет применение стандартных методов анализа вредоносного кода. Delphi, в свою очередь, известен своей способностью создавать компактные и эффективные приложения, что также усложняет их детектирование антивирусными системами.
@prog_tools
Разработчик объяснил, почему Vibe Coding — это лишь хайповый инструмент, а не замена инженерам
С легкой руки Андрея Карпаты (сооснователя OpenAI) термин «вайб-кодинг» ворвался в мир разработки и спровоцировал целый шквал запугивающих статей об отъеме работы у кодеров. Однако та часть опытных программистов, что справились со своими неврозами, аргументируют за сохранение кодерских рабочих мест.
@prog_tools
С легкой руки Андрея Карпаты (сооснователя OpenAI) термин «вайб-кодинг» ворвался в мир разработки и спровоцировал целый шквал запугивающих статей об отъеме работы у кодеров. Однако та часть опытных программистов, что справились со своими неврозами, аргументируют за сохранение кодерских рабочих мест.
@prog_tools
Семь API, которые сократят вам недели разработки
В статье на Tproger собрали 10 API, которые помогут вам сократить время на реализацию проектов. Здесь и интерфейсы для поиска уязвимостей, проксирования и даже объединения разных API в потоки действий.
@prog_tools
В статье на Tproger собрали 10 API, которые помогут вам сократить время на реализацию проектов. Здесь и интерфейсы для поиска уязвимостей, проксирования и даже объединения разных API в потоки действий.
@prog_tools
Какие есть паттерны в React и для чего они нужны: часть 1
Отличный гайд для неофитов фреймворка, c его помощью вы познакомитесь с компонентным подходом, методами управления состоянием — контекстом и Redux. Также там про паттерн «Высший порядок» для переиспользования кода.
@prog_tools
Отличный гайд для неофитов фреймворка, c его помощью вы познакомитесь с компонентным подходом, методами управления состоянием — контекстом и Redux. Также там про паттерн «Высший порядок» для переиспользования кода.
@prog_tools
hasura.io | Самый быстрый способ создать API
ИИ-экосистема для создателей API, которая в сократит вам часы работы. С помощью короткого промта вы сможете:
— собрать API на нескольких языках с желаемым инструментарием;
— задеплоить его на поддомене Hasura;
— доработать интерфейс при необходимости.
⚡ — пишу API
🗿 — не доводилось писать API
Цена: есть условно-бесплатный тариф
Сайт проекта
@prog_tools
ИИ-экосистема для создателей API, которая в сократит вам часы работы. С помощью короткого промта вы сможете:
— собрать API на нескольких языках с желаемым инструментарием;
— задеплоить его на поддомене Hasura;
— доработать интерфейс при необходимости.
⚡ — пишу API
🗿 — не доводилось писать API
Цена: есть условно-бесплатный тариф
Сайт проекта
@prog_tools
Какие есть паттерны в React и для чего они нужны: часть 2
Паттерны проектирования — ключ к эффективной разработке на React. Во второй части цикла статей Senior Dev из Вконтакте показал, как различные паттерны могут улучшить структуру и производительность. Хуки + серверные компоненты = будущее.
p.s. Первая часть здесь.
@prog_tools
Паттерны проектирования — ключ к эффективной разработке на React. Во второй части цикла статей Senior Dev из Вконтакте показал, как различные паттерны могут улучшить структуру и производительность. Хуки + серверные компоненты = будущее.
p.s. Первая часть здесь.
@prog_tools
neapolitan | CRUD-вьюхи для Django в мгновение ока
Тулза для Django, которая ускорит создание CRUD для ваших моделей. Библиотека автоматизирует создание:
— Стандартных представлений: для списка, деталей, создания, редактирования и удаления моделей;
— Настраиваемых хуков: возможность изменять поведение представлений по мере необходимости;
— Базовых шаблонов и повторно используемых тегов: упрощается рендеринг моделей на веб-странице.
Цена: бесплатно
Репозиторий проекта
Тулза для Django, которая ускорит создание CRUD для ваших моделей. Библиотека автоматизирует создание:
— Стандартных представлений: для списка, деталей, создания, редактирования и удаления моделей;
— Настраиваемых хуков: возможность изменять поведение представлений по мере необходимости;
— Базовых шаблонов и повторно используемых тегов: упрощается рендеринг моделей на веб-странице.
Цена: бесплатно
Репозиторий проекта
qdrant | Высокопроизводительный масштабируемый векторный поиск
Инструмент предлагает беспрецедентное удобство не только для строки поиска на вашем сайте, но для RAG, дата-аналитики, поиска аномалий, систем рекомендации и многого другого. Клиент на Python / Rust / TypeScript / Java / Go / C#.
Инструмент-победитель в номинации «Суперхранилище» 📦
Цена: есть условно-бесплатный тариф
Сайт проекта
@prog_tools
Инструмент предлагает беспрецедентное удобство не только для строки поиска на вашем сайте, но для RAG, дата-аналитики, поиска аномалий, систем рекомендации и многого другого. Клиент на Python / Rust / TypeScript / Java / Go / C#.
Инструмент-победитель в номинации «Суперхранилище» 📦
Цена: есть условно-бесплатный тариф
Сайт проекта
@prog_tools
Forwarded from IT Юмор
Это называется спуфинг 😉
Но вы наверняка это знаете если интересуетесь кибербезом. Мы, команда Tproger, хотим узнать насколько сильно и предлагаем пройти небольшой опрос по этой теме.
Пин-коды спрашивать не будем🆗
@ithumor
Но вы наверняка это знаете если интересуетесь кибербезом. Мы, команда Tproger, хотим узнать насколько сильно и предлагаем пройти небольшой опрос по этой теме.
Пин-коды спрашивать не будем
@ithumor
Please open Telegram to view this post
VIEW IN TELEGRAM
superblocks.com | ИИ-монстр для разработки веб-приложений
Воистину Agentic Access — новый тренд 2025 года. Компании одна за одной «не могут победить [GPT], потому возглавляют" движение ПО, с которым можно общаться промтами. На сей раз SuperBlocks представляет собой не просто конструктор прототипов, но способ сразу:
— спроектировать MVP на React с Cursor / Windsurf;
— подвести базу данных или другой инструмент из десятков доступных;
— настроить SSO и разрешения;
— задеплоить на поддомене superblocks.com;
— поработать над безопасностью и тонны других возможностей.
Инструмент-победитель в номинации «Сохранятор времени кодера» ⏳
Краткий обзор на замедленотьюбе
Цена: бесплатно
Сайт проекта
@prog_tools
Воистину Agentic Access — новый тренд 2025 года. Компании одна за одной «не могут победить [GPT], потому возглавляют" движение ПО, с которым можно общаться промтами. На сей раз SuperBlocks представляет собой не просто конструктор прототипов, но способ сразу:
— спроектировать MVP на React с Cursor / Windsurf;
— подвести базу данных или другой инструмент из десятков доступных;
— настроить SSO и разрешения;
— задеплоить на поддомене superblocks.com;
— поработать над безопасностью и тонны других возможностей.
Инструмент-победитель в номинации «Сохранятор времени кодера» ⏳
Краткий обзор на замедленотьюбе
Цена: бесплатно
Сайт проекта
@prog_tools
PostgreSQL vs. ClickHouse vs. DuckDB: какую опенсорс базу выбрать для аналитики в 2025 году?
В Tproger сравнили популярных опенсорс-решения и рассмотрели ключевые особенности СУБД: производительность, масштабируемость и удобство. Вы узнаете, какая из них лучше справляется с большими объемами данных, а также какие сценарии использования подходят для каждой системы.
@prog_tools
В Tproger сравнили популярных опенсорс-решения и рассмотрели ключевые особенности СУБД: производительность, масштабируемость и удобство. Вы узнаете, какая из них лучше справляется с большими объемами данных, а также какие сценарии использования подходят для каждой системы.
@prog_tools
Как нейронки — копайлоты программиста повлияют на зарплаты?
Anonymous Poll
16%
Снизят доход
11%
Повысят доход
44%
Плюс на минус, и вот доход тот же
30%
Хочу увидеть результат
OWASP: какие уязвимости встречаются чаще всего?
Каждые 39 секунд в мире происходит успешная кибератака, и 9 из 10 из них используют уязвимости из списка OWASP. В cтатье проанализировали критичные уязвимости веб-приложений, а также ошибки проектирования, неправильную конфигурацию и устаревшие компоненты, что приводят к появлению бэкдоров.
@prog_tools
Каждые 39 секунд в мире происходит успешная кибератака, и 9 из 10 из них используют уязвимости из списка OWASP. В cтатье проанализировали критичные уязвимости веб-приложений, а также ошибки проектирования, неправильную конфигурацию и устаревшие компоненты, что приводят к появлению бэкдоров.
@prog_tools